What role does leadership play in quality management?

Explanation:
Leadership plays a crucial role in quality management by setting the vision, direction, and culture that are essential for fostering a quality-oriented organization. Effective leaders establish a clear vision for quality, which helps align the efforts of all team members towards common quality objectives. They communicate the importance of quality initiatives, ensuring that everyone understands their role in achieving these goals. Furthermore, leadership influences the organizational culture by promoting values that prioritize quality. This can involve encouraging open communication, collaboration, and a commitment to continuous improvement. When leaders visibly support and participate in quality management practices, they inspire others to embrace these values, creating a cohesive approach to quality throughout the organization.
